Could I draw your attention to a great position that we have available to join a two year, MRC DPFS-funded project to provide structural and biophysical input to a drug discovery project in the CRUK Newcastle Drug Discovery Unit.
The project is pursuing an exciting structural hypothesis to develop therapies to address an unmet need for treatments for patients with ovarian cancer. It is currently in early lead optimisation, and the post holder will be joining a well founded
team to develop and apply techniques of structural biology (crystallography/cryo EM), biophysics (SPR/ITC), and cellular and cell-free assays to progress the project towards clinical candidate selection.
